Common Causes of Unusual Outdoor Unit Sounds

Heat pumps can make a variety of sounds, each indicating a different issue. Addressing these can ensure your system runs smoothly and efficiently:

1. Misaligned or Loose Parts

- Over time, the components within your heat pump might shift or become loose. As parts become misaligned, they can begin to rub against each other, causing strange noises. This is especially true if your heat pump has been operating without recent maintenance, leading to wear and tear. Taking swift action can prevent further damage from occurring.

2. Debris and Obstructions

- The outdoor unit of your heat pump is exposed to the elements, and debris such as leaves, sticks, and dirt can accumulate over time. These obstructions can interfere with the fan or other moving parts, creating unusual sounds. Regular cleaning and inspection of the outdoor unit can help clear these obstructions before they become problematic.

3. Refrigerant Levels

- Low or unbalanced refrigerant levels can also lead to unusual sounds coming from your heat pump. This can include hissing or bubbling noises, which are indicative of leaks in the system. Ensuring that refrigerant levels are kept within optimal ranges not only prevents damage but also maintains efficiency.

Diagnostic Steps to Identify the Source of the Noise

When your heat pump starts emitting strange sounds, it's time to take some diagnostic steps to pinpoint the issue. Start with a simple visual inspection. Open the cover of the outdoor unit and carefully examine the components. Look for signs of wear, misalignment, or obstructions. Loose screws or bolts might just need tightening, which can be a quick fix to reduce odd noises. Make sure to switch off the power to the unit when you perform this inspection to ensure safety.

Next, listen closely to determine the type of noise and its source. Different sounds can indicate different issues. A rattling noise might suggest something is loose, while a hissing sound could indicate a refrigerant leak. Pay attention to when you hear these noises. Do they occur more frequently during startup or while the system is running at full capacity? These observations will be valuable when discussing the problem with our technicians.

If the issue persists after your initial inspection and listening session, it's crucial to get a professional assessment. Our professionals have the tools and expertise to accurately identify and resolve problems that might not be visible to the untrained eye. They can test refrigerant levels, check electrical connections, and ensure all components are in proper working condition.

Prepare your heat pump for the changing seasons with these tips specific to Okotoks:

- Spring and Summer: Clean debris from around the outdoor unit and clear any blockages. Ensure the area is clear and that airflow is unobstructed.

- Fall and Winter: Have our professionals inspect the heat pump to confirm it's ready for the colder months. Clean the filters and check the defrost cycle.

When to Call a Professional

Knowing when to call in the experts can save you time and stress. Here are some clear signs that professional help is needed:

- Persistent or unexplained noises that do not stop even after basic inspections or adjustments.

- Changes in performance, such as reduced heating or cooling ability.

- Unusual smells or signs of moisture accumulation, which could indicate a refrigerant issue or leak.
